Output e4ecfc26b6ccb0064353949f4c30a42e495b1c5ef41242e0ce9a84df2e72fb1b:0

value
200000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 607a833051b3202ba618861b2c42fa8887e75f83 OP_EQUALVERIFY OP_CHECKSIG
address
19o8djN4DCWHEjeprFNtNVp8PW8dE2eKuL
transaction
e4ecfc26b6ccb0064353949f4c30a42e495b1c5ef41242e0ce9a84df2e72fb1b
confirmations
316138
spent
true